Echoes of Yesterday

The Scarcity of Lasting Relationships

The renewal of a rare connection

Once we were close, bound by trust,

A bond so strong, we felt a rush.

We shared our secrets, rare and few,

And thought our friendship was brand new.

~~~

But now we stand, with awkward grace,

Our friendship torn, a changed embrace.

We talk in whispers, eyes downcast,

Our words so careful, so unsurpassed.

~~~

The memories linger, sweet and bright,

Of laughter shared in the dead of night.

We'd talk of dreams, and love, and life,

And everything seemed to just feel right.

~~~

But now we stand, divided, rare,

Our friendship lost, beyond repair.

We’ve each moved on, with little care,

And left the past, just a distant flare.

~~~

Yet still, I find myself drawn back,

To times we shared, and all we lack.

For though our friendship may be rare,

It's worth the effort, and I’ll repair.

~~~

So here I stand, with open heart,

And ask for your forgiveness, play a part.

In rebuilding what we once had,

And making our friendship strong and glad.

~~~

So let us start, with a new beat,

And make this friendship, complete.

Let's bask in memories, once again,

And let our love, a new journey begin.

~~~

For you, my friend, are rare and bright,

And though we've changed, we still ignite.

That spark within, that love so true,

And I’ll cherish it, for always, for you.
